At Wareham station, the ticket office is open for various hours over the week, ensuring you can grab tickets at your convenience. From Monday to Friday, service begins at 06:10 and ends at 18:30, while Saturday hours are slightly shorter, 07:15 to 13:50. On Sundays, you can catch them from 10:00 to 14:00. If you're someone who prefers to plan ahead, tickets purchased online can be easily collected at the station's available machine. Moreover, all ticket machines are accessible and offer disc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ders. While smartcards are not issued on site, validators are available for commuters who prefer this modern method.
Wareham offers step-free access in parts, with level access to both platforms and a waiting room located on Platform 2. A heated environment provides added comfort during the colder months. Accessible toilets and induction loops are available, though it must be noted that staff assistance is not offered on-site. However, the trained guards on South Western Railway trains are there to help, ensuring a smooth experience when boarding or alighting. For any travel assistance, you can also use their Assisted Boarding Points service.
Wareham station is well-connected with other transport modes, including bus services. Bus shelters can be found on Sandford Road Roundabout for easy access. For cyclists, bicycle hire is available near the forecourt, perfect for those wanting to explore the surrounding picturesque area. For those considering a visit to Ravenglass for Eskdale station, prepare for a station experience that values accessibility and simplicity. While there is no ticket office, convenient ticket machines are at hand for purchasing and collecting tickets, ensuring a hassle-free start to your journey. Although staff assistance is unavailable, rest assured that the station is equipped with step-free access throughout, allowing an effortless transition between platforms for all travelers.
Whether you’re traveling with family or solo, you'll find essential amenities such as comfortable seating areas. However, note that advanced facilities like waiting rooms, shops, or refreshment outlets are unfortunately absent, making it wise to come prepared with any necessities. Wi-Fi is accessible, ensuring a seamless connection to the digital world, allowing you to plan further travel or share your picturesque journey online.
Reaching Ravenglass is as fascinating as the journeys you embark on from here. While the station lacks dedicated parking facilities, rail replacement services and taxis are conveniently operated from the nearby station car park. The bus services in the area can be reached via Busline at 0871 200 2233, providing further access to the surrounding attractions. However, there are no rental bicycles available at the station, which might inspire visitors to enjoy the joys of walking amidst magnificent surroundings.
